My story

A portion of my adoption fee has been sponsored by my friends at Tito's Handmade Vodka. The adoption fee sponsorship credit of $375.00 will be applied during the contract process. Hi, my name is Rocket! I'm an owner surrender from Minnesota. My name is Rocket, but my foster family calls me Mary Lou. Mary Lou has been living with us for quite a while now and she is such a fun and loving girl. She is very energetic and LOVES games! Mary Lou enjoys playing with her toys and chasing balls in the backyard. She even made up a game of hide and seek and trained us how to play! Mary Lou is very playful and incredibly smart! A good nap on the couch or under your desk at your feet is also appreciated, because it can wear a puppy out playing so hard. It is one of the cutest things ever when she gets the zoomies; she is so fast! Mary Lou, is also good about entertaining herself and will settle down and work on a bone if it isn’t time for playing together. Mary Lou would be best in a home where she isn’t left alone for too long. She has never had any accidents in the house and isn’t destructive at all, but she definitely prefers to be in the company of others. Mary Lou, is on medication for her anxiety and is working hard with her trainer; she has come a long way since she first arrived at our house! She’ll need to continue with medication and her adoption includes some training sessions. We’ve seen a ton of improvement, but coordinated introductions with people continue to be necessary. A home with a fenced in yard and no shared walls are also necessary. A quieter street would be amazing for her. Going on walks, meeting other dogs, and dealing with loud noises are other things she can work on with you and her trainer. From her non-reaction to the rabbits and squirrels in our backyard it appears she doesn’t have a strong prey drive, but it is unknown how she would do with cats. For now, she would thrive being the only animal in the household. Everyone, even the “not dog people”, fall in love with Miss Mary Lou. If you can put in the time to help her feel safe and see how great life can be, you will be rewarded with her charming smile, her sweet snores, and a buddy who is always at your side. Mary Lou is a real gem!
